Erythropoietin (EPO)
A. acts by increasing the production of red blood cells by cells in the bone marrow.
B. is secreted by peritubular interstitial cells of the kidney cortex.
C. levels in the blood plasma serve as an actuating signal in a long-term negative feedback loop that controls the amount of oxygen in the peritubular interstitial spaces of the kidney cortex.

What are the major terrestrial biomes? The main terrestrial biomes are: tundra, taigas (or boreal forest), temperate forests, tropical forests, grasslands and deserts.
